编程什么是相对运动的

编程什么是相对运动的

相对运动是指物体相对于观察参照物的运动状态。1、它表明了在不同的参照系下,物体运动状态的相对性。在物理学中,运动与参照系的选择有密切联系,没有绝对的运动状态只有相对的运动状态。

在深入探讨相对运动时,特别强调的关键点在于参照系的选取。通俗而言,如果你站在行驶的火车上,相对于火车你是静止的;但如果站在地面上观察,你和火车一起在移动。因此,相对运动的描述需要明确指出参照物是什么,而这正是物理学中研究运动时的重要概念。

一、相对运动的定义

相对运动是指在不同参照系中所观察到的物体的运动情况,这些参照系相对于彼此可能处于静止或者运动状态。 在现实世界中,绝大多数的运动都可以被视为相对运动,因为我们可以从不同的参照系来观察同一个运动事件,从而得到不同的运动描述。

理解相对运动的概念,首先需要掌握参照系(Reference Frame)的定义。在物理学中,参照系是用来测量和描述物体位置的坐标系,可以是一个物理对象,也可以是数学上的坐标格网。参照系可以是静止的,也可以是运动的。从不同的参照系观察相同的运动现象,会得到不同的运动速度和方向表述。

二、参照系的选择

选择合适的参照系对于分析相对运动是至关重要的。 参照系可以是任意的物体或点,但在实际应用中,通常选择容易观察到的大型物体或明显的界标作为参照点。例如,研究天体运动时,常取地球或太阳作为参照系;在交通系统中,我们可能将地面作为参照系来分析车辆的相对速度。

对于参照系的选择,我们还应该注意到惯性参照系和非惯性参照系的差别。在惯性参照系中,任意两个没有受力或受力平衡的物体相对于这个参照系是静止或做匀速直线运动的。而在非惯性参照系中,由于参照系自身的加速度存在,物体会表现出额外的惯性力,这在分析运动问题时会增加复杂性。

三、运动的相对性原理

伽利略的相对性原理表述了在所有惯性参照系中,物理定律都有相同的形式。 这意味着没有一种物理试验能够区分处于静止还是均匀直线运动的惯性参照系。尽管在不同的惯性参照系中,物体的运动状态看起来可能不同,但这些基本的物理规律在各个惯性参照系中是不变的。

这个原理对于理解相对运动至关重要。根据这个原理,如果在一个未被外部力作用所扰动的封闭室内,无法通过任何物理实验来判断室内是静止还是以匀速直线运动。也就是说,无论是静止还是均匀直线运动的观测者所观测到的物理现象是相同的。

四、分析相对运动

在进行相对运动的分析时,我们使用数学语言中向量的加减法来表达不同参照系中物体速度的关系。如果已知一个物体相对于参照系A的速度和参照系A相对于参照系B的速度,那么我们可以计算该物体相对于参照系B的速度。

物体相对于参照系B的速度等于它相对于参照系A的速度与参照系A相对于参照系B的速度之和。 这个应用向量加法的结果,被称为速度的相对性。这一数学描述是分析各种相对运动情形的基础。

分析相对运动时,我们必须明确转换参照系的参数,这包括速度的大小与方向,以及参照系之间的相对速度。应用正确的物理公式和数学计算方法,可以精确描述出相对运动的整体特征。

五、在不同领域的应用

相对运动的概念在各个科学和工程领域都有广泛的应用。在航天工程中,飞行器在不同参照系之间的相对运动分析对于导航和对接任务至关重要。在机器人技术中,相对于工作平台和周围环境的运动分析是实现精确控制的基础。此外,在日常生活的交通模拟、竞赛策略分析、图像处理等方面,相对运动的理论也被广泛应用。

理解和分析相对运动,有助于我们准确预测和描述物体在不同参照系下的运动状态,是现代科学理论和工程实践的基石之一。

相对运动的概念不仅加深了我们对于物理世界的认识,同时也是许多复杂系统设计和分析的基础,如全球定位系统(GPS)定位精度的提升,也是基于对地球和卫星之间相对运动的深入理解。

总结

相对运动是物理学中的一个重要概念,它反映了运动状态的相对性和参照系选择对于运动描述的影响。通过明确参考系的选择和应用相对性原理,可以更准确地分析和计算在不同参照系下物体的运动。这一理论不仅在基础物理研究领域有着广泛应用,也是现代技术如航天、机器人控制和GPS等高精度系统不可或缺的分析工具。

相关问答FAQs:

什么是相对运动?

相对运动是指物体或者观察点相对于其他物体或者参考点的运动。在物理学中,相对运动涉及到描述物体之间的运动关系,即物体相互之间的距离和速度的变化。

如何描述相对运动?

为了描述相对运动,我们需要确定一个参考点或者参考物体。这个参考点可以是一个固定的物体,也可以是其他移动的物体。接下来,我们观察目标物体相对于参考点的运动。

什么是相对速度?

相对速度是指两个物体之间的速度差异。假设物体A相对于物体B以一定的速度运动,而物体B相对于物体C以另一种速度运动。这时,我们可以通过计算两个速度的差异得到物体A和物体C之间的相对速度。

除了上述3个问题以外,还可以探讨一些相关的问题,如:

  • 相对运动的例子有哪些?
  • 如何计算相对速度?
  • 相对运动与绝对运动有什么不同?
  • 相对运动在什么领域有重要的应用?
  • 相对运动如何影响运动物体的物理性质?
    等等。

总而言之,相对运动是物理学中一个重要的概念,可以帮助我们理解物体之间的运动关系。通过研究相对运动,我们可以更好地理解和描述物体的运动行为,在许多实际应用中有着广泛的应用价值。

文章标题:编程什么是相对运动的,发布者:不及物动词,转载请注明出处:https://worktile.com/kb/p/1616073

(0)
打赏 微信扫一扫 微信扫一扫 支付宝扫一扫 支付宝扫一扫
不及物动词不及物动词管理员
上一篇 2024年4月27日
下一篇 2024年4月27日

相关推荐

  • 什么是WebRTC服务器

    WebRTC(Web Real-Time Communication)服务器,是指运行WebRTC协议的服务器,用于实现网页浏览器之间的实时音视频通信和数据共享。WebRTC是一个开源项目,它的目标是使得网页应用程序能够进行实时通信(RTC),无需任何插件或者第三方软件。 WebRTC(Web Re…

    2023年7月18日
    65600
  • 手机什么软件学编程好学

    在众多应用中,有三款软件格外适合学习编程:1、Codecademy Go,2、SoloLearn,3、Enki。特别是Codecademy Go,在学习效率和互动性方面表现优异。它不仅提供了广泛的语言和技术栈的课程,还通过挑战和项目实践的方式,加深用户对编程概念的理解。 一、CODECADEMY G…

    2024年4月27日
    3700
  • oa erp系统

    ### 摘要 OA和ERP系统被视为提高公司管理效率和业务流程自动化的关键工具。OA系统,即办公自动化系统,旨在优化办公室管理和日常行政任务,而ERP系统,即企业资源规划系统,则侧重于集成所有业务管理的功能,包括供应链管理、库存、账户等。OA系统通常强调内部沟通与文档流转,1、ERP则专注于资源的最…

    2024年1月16日
    22200
  • devops工具什么品牌好

    关于哪种DevOps工具品牌优异,1、自动化与集成能力、2、社区与支持力度、3、灵活性与兼容性、4、性价比这四点不可忽视。具体而言,1、自动化与集成能力强的工具可以极大地简化开发和运维过程,提高效率;该类工具通常提供连贯的流水线与一键部署选项。2、社区与支持力度则体现在使用基数广泛、拥有活跃社区以及…

    2024年3月26日
    8400
  • 在线编程一般用什么语言

    在线编程常使用的语言有JavaScript、Python、Java和C#。其中,JavaScript 在在线编程领域占据了独特的地位。它与HTML和CSS共同构成了网页的三大核心技术,特别适合于开发交互式的网页和应用程序。JavaScript的灵活性、易学性和强大的前端框架生态圈是其广泛使用的主要原…

    2024年4月27日
    3700
  • 数控编程专业是学什么课程

    数控编程专业主要学习使用计算机辅助设计和制造(CAD/CAM)软件进行编程,以及数控机床(CNC)的操作和管理。 在这个领域内,重点课程往往包括数控机床原理、工艺过程设计、编程基础、CAD/CAM软件应用等。学生将通过这些课程学习如何设计机器加工的零件,并且创建相应的机器程序来生产这些零件。举例来说…

    2024年4月27日
    4400
  • 编程班开业送什么礼品

    编程班开业送礼品时,推荐的选择包括1、科技相关图书、2、定制U盘、3、办公用品、4、编程软件订阅或者5、教学资源打印券。在这些选择中,尤以科技相关图书为优,因为这样的礼品不仅实用而且能够为编程班的学习环境添砖加瓦。图书可以针对编程班学员的水平和兴趣度身定制,比如可以是面向初学者的编程基础书籍,或者针…

    2024年5月7日
    900
  • 如何在Excel中创建一个基本的甘特图

    创建甘特图的关键步骤包括选择适合的条形图、添加任务数据、定制条形颜色与格式设置;将任务时长转化为条形图是展示项目时间线的关键环节,需注意条形颜色和文本的可读性提升图表效果。在Excel中制作甘特图,你需唯一依赖条形图工具、改造默认设置以适应项目管理需求。在此过程中,将特定任务对应到时间轴上,颜色编码…

    2023年12月20日
    31900
  • 编程语言再次洗牌是什么

    编程语言再次洗牌主要指的是1、技术发展推动新语言诞生、2、旧语言升级适应新需求、3、生态系统变革影响语言流行度。这种现象通过不断地技术革新和市场需求的变化,促进了编程语言的进化和优化。以技术发展推动新语言诞生为例,随着云计算、大数据、AI等技术的崛起,对编程语言提出了新的要求。这些要求不仅仅局限于性…

    2024年4月27日
    4300
  • grub命令有哪些

    grub命令有:1、background;2、blocklist;3、boot;4、bootp;5、cat;6、chainloader;7、clear;8、cmp;9、color;10、configfile;11、debug;12、default;13、device;14、dhcp;15、displ…

    2023年1月13日
    2.5K00

发表回复

登录后才能评论
注册PingCode 在线客服
站长微信
站长微信
电话联系

400-800-1024

工作日9:30-21:00在线

分享本页
返回顶部